211,486,965,533 is a prime number. Like all primes greater than two, it is odd and has no factors apart from itself and one.

Names of 211486965533

  • Cardinal: 211486965533 can be written as Two hundred eleven billion, four hundred eighty-six million, nine hundred sixty-five thousand, five hundred thirty-three.

Scientific notation

  • Scientific notation: 2.11486965533 × 1011

Factors of 211486965533

  • Number of distinct prime factors ω(n): 1
  • Total number of prime factors Ω(n): 1
  • Sum of prime factors: 211486965533

Divisors of 211486965533

  • Number of divisors d(n): 2
  • Complete list of divisors:
  • Sum of all divisors σ(n): 211486965534
  •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 1
  • 211486965533 is a deficient number, because the sum of its proper divisors (1) is less than itself. Its deficiency is 211486965532

Bases of 211486965533

  • Binary: 110001001111011001101011111111000111012
  • Hexadecimal: 0x313D9AFF1D
  • Base-36: 2P5LVMZH

Squares and roots of 211486965533

  • 211486965533 squared (2114869655332) is 44726736590356329974089
  • 211486965533 cubed (2114869655333) is 9459121799688259097418535126074437
  • The square root of 211486965533 is 459877.1200364289
  • The cube root of 211486965533 is 5957.9181873479
